Understanding the Importance of‍ SEL in Schools

SEL refers to the process through ‍which students ⁤acquire and apply​ the knowledge, attitudes, and skills necessary to understand and ‍manage emotions,‍ set goals, show empathy, build positive relationships, and make responsible decisions. Research consistently shows ‍that effective ⁤ SEL programs in ⁢schools lead to:

  • Improved academic performance
  • better ⁣classroom behavior
  • Reduced emotional distress
  • Enhanced resilience and well-being

As the world becomes more​ interconnected ‌and complex, the‍ future of education ⁣hinges on embedding robust SEL frameworks into K-12 curricula.

Emerging Trends Shaping the Future of SEL

SEL ‍is evolving rapidly to address new challenges and leverage modern opportunities. Here are the leading⁤ SEL trends in schools shaping the years ahead:

1. Integration of SEL with Academic Learning

Forward-thinking schools are seamlessly integrating SEL with core academic ‍subjects. Rather than being taught in isolation,SEL is woven into language arts,math,science,and social studies,helping students connect emotional skills ⁣with everyday learning experiences.

2. Leveraging Technology for Scalable SEL Solutions

With⁤ the ⁣proliferation of EdTech,digital ⁤SEL resources ​are becoming mainstream. Platforms and apps offer interactive SEL lessons, gamified ‍activities, and ⁤data insights to personalize student support. Features such as ⁣virtual check-ins and AI-driven feedback enable educators to monitor and nurture student well-being effectively.

3. Focus on Equity and Culturally Responsive SEL

Cultural ⁢relevance‌ in SEL programs is vital.Schools​ are embracing culturally responsive SEL by tailoring⁣ activities to⁣ honor students’ backgrounds and community norms. This fosters inclusivity, promotes social justice, and ensures ​that every learner ​feels seen and valued.

4. ⁤Expanding‍ SEL Beyond the Classroom

SEL’s reach now extends ‍beyond ‌classroom walls through family and community engagement. Schools are providing SEL resources for parents, hosting workshops, and building⁤ community partnerships, ensuring a 360-degree approach to student well-being.

5. Measuring⁣ SEL Outcomes with Data

Data-driven approaches are revolutionizing SEL assessment, allowing educators to monitor growth⁢ in real time. Emerging tools help collect and⁤ analyze student SEL data, empowering schools to refine strategies, demonstrate impact, and secure ongoing support.

Innovative Strategies to Advance SEL in ⁣Schools

Harnessing the full potential of SEL in schools requires creative, ‍actionable strategies. Here’s how educational leaders and teachers‌ are taking SEL to the next level:

  • Project-Based Learning: Embedding SEL competencies into collaborative, real-world projects strengthens critical thinking and teamwork.
  • Restorative Practices: Using restorative circles and conflict resolution activities‍ cultivates empathy and accountability.
  • Peer Mentorship: Student-led SEL initiatives and mentorship programs boost leadership and​ reinforce positive​ behavior.
  • Mindfulness and Wellness ⁣programs: Incorporating mindfulness exercises, breathing techniques, and stress management supports emotional regulation and mental health.
  • Professional Development: Ongoing SEL training ensures that teachers and ​staff⁣ model SEL skills and maintain a supportive learning environment.

The ⁣Benefits of Future-Oriented SEL

Future-ready SEL frameworks offer long-lasting advantages ​for schools, students,‍ and communities:

  • Higher Academic Achievement: Students with strong SEL skills show improved grades and higher graduation rates.
  • Social Cohesion: SEL strengthens classroom communities,reduces bullying,and enhances peer‌ relationships.
  • Workforce Readiness: SEL skills such as‍ communication, emotional ​regulation, and adaptability are invaluable ⁢for future ‌careers.
  • Mental Health Support: Proactive SEL helps identify mental health needs early, connecting students to resources before issues escalate.

Practical Tips for Implementing Future SEL in Schools

To stay ahead in the evolving SEL landscape, education ⁣leaders can adopt these ⁤proven strategies:

  • Establish a Vision: Develop ⁣a shared SEL mission that aligns with your ​school’s values and ‍academic goals.
  • Invest in ​Professional Learning: Empower ⁤educators with​ ongoing SEL training and opportunities for ⁣reflection.
  • Leverage Technology: Utilize SEL​ apps, digital assessments, and online collaboration tools to ⁤foster engagement and ‌track progress.
  • Build Partnerships: ‍Collaborate with families, ​mental health professionals, and community organizations ⁣to create a holistic SEL ecosystem.
  • Customize SEL: Adapt SEL lessons and activities to fit your school’s unique culture,language,and student needs.
